Rabbi Mike Moskowitz is the Director of Scholarship and Multi-faith Engagement at The Beacon. For the past seven years he served as the Scholar-in-Residence for Trans and Queer Jewish Studies at CBST, the world’s largest LGBT synagogue. Rabbi Moskowitz received three Ultra-Orthodox ordinations while learning in the Mir in Jerusalem and BMG in Lakewood, NJ. He is a Wexner Field Fellow, Senior Rabbinic Fellow at the Hartman Institute, and the author of Textual Activism, Graceful Masculinity, Seasonal Resistance, and Ancestral Allyship. His newest book, Inviting Order, will be out in time for Passover 2026.
